Tea alligation with three varieties: Tea priced at ₹ 126/kg and ₹ 135/kg are mixed with a third variety in the ratio 1 : 1 : 2. If the final mixture is worth ₹ 153/kg, find the price per kg of the third variety.

Difficulty: Easy

Correct Answer: ₹ 175.50

Explanation:


Introduction / Context:
When three price points are mixed in a fixed quantity ratio, the overall price is the weighted average. Here, the third variety has an unknown price that must make the average equal to ₹ 153/kg across four equal parts (1 + 1 + 2).


Given Data / Assumptions:

  • Prices: ₹ 126, ₹ 135, and ₹ x (unknown).
  • Mix ratio: 1 : 1 : 2 (total parts = 4).
  • Mixture price = ₹ 153/kg.


Concept / Approach:
Use weighted average: (126*1 + 135*1 + x*2) / 4 = 153. Solve for x to get the third variety’s price per kilogram.


Step-by-Step Solution:

(126 + 135 + 2x) / 4 = 153261 + 2x = 6122x = 351 ⇒ x = 175.50


Verification / Alternative check:
Substitute x = 175.50: (126 + 135 + 351) / 4 = 612 / 4 = 153, exactly as required.



Why Other Options Are Wrong:
Values like ₹ 170 or ₹ 180 shift the weighted average below or above ₹ 153; only ₹ 175.50 balances the 1 : 1 : 2 mix.



Common Pitfalls:
Taking a simple average of the three prices instead of a weighted average according to 1 : 1 : 2.



Final Answer:
₹ 175.50
